Essential Tech Acronyms Unveiled: What They Mean

Acronyms Explained:

1. GPS: Global Positioning System – A navigation system that uses satellite signals to determine a location.

2. KYC: Know Your Customer – A process for verifying the identity of clients in financial services.

3. PDF: Portable Document Format – A file format used to present documents consistently across various devices.

4. PNG: Portable Network Graphics – A raster graphics file format that supports lossless compression.

5. JPEG: Joint Photographic Experts Group – A commonly used method of lossy compression for digital images.

6. URL: Uniform Resource Locator – The address used to access resources on the internet.

7. WWW: World Wide Web – An information system where documents and other web resources are accessed via the internet.

8. PAN: Permanent Account Number – A unique identifier issued to individuals and businesses for tax purposes in some countries.

9. HTML: Hypertext Markup Language – The standard language used to create and design web pages.

10. CSS: Cascading Style Sheets – A style sheet language used to describe the presentation of a document written in HTML or XML.

11. HTTP: Hypertext Transfer Protocol – The protocol used for transmitting hypertext via the internet.

12. HTTPS: Hypertext Transfer Protocol Secure – An extension of HTTP with added security for safe communication over a network.

13. API: Application Programming Interface – A set of rules and tools for building software applications and enabling them to communicate.

14. SQL: Structured Query Language – A standard language used for managing and manipulating databases.

15. IoT: Internet of Things – The interconnection of everyday devices through the internet, allowing them to send and receive data.

16. AI: Artificial Intelligence – The simulation of human intelligence processes by machines, especially computer systems.

My friends often ask me, 'What is the full form of PIN?' or 'What does OTP mean?' And honestly, these are some of the most crucial ones for daily life! PIN, as in Personal Identification Number, is something we use every single day for our bank cards, phones, and more. And OTP? That's One-Time Password, a temporary code you get for secure logins. Knowing these two alone has saved me from so much confusion and kept my online activities safer. Then there are those other essential abbreviations that help us navigate the modern landscape. Take QR code, for example. It stands for Quick Response code, and it’s everywhere now, from menus to payments. And remember when SMS (Short Message Service) and MMS (Multimedia Messaging Service) were revolutionary? They're still the backbone of basic text communication! Even WiFi, which means Wireless Fidelity, is something we rely on constantly but might not know the full form of. And who doesn't love a good GIF (Graphics Interchange Format) to express themselves in a chat? These are all 'very important words' that pop up daily, and knowing their full forms helps you feel more connected and informed. Beyond just tech, message short forms and abbreviations are a huge part of how we communicate, especially in casual chatting. Ever seen someone type 'LOL' and wondered what it meant? That's Laughing Out Loud. Or 'BRB' for Be Right Back? These aren't always tech-specific but are common short forms in chatting that streamline conversations. Think about 'IMHO' (In My Humble Opinion) or 'BTW' (By The Way). Learning these common abbreviations has not only sped up my texting but also made me feel more part of online communities.
